Структура молекулярного димерного алкоксокомплексу хрому (ІІІ) з диметил-N-трихлороацетиламідофосфатом
Є.А. Труш, В.А. Труш, К.В. Домасевич, В.М. Амірханов
Abstract
A new coordination compound of chromium (III) with dimethyl-N-trichloroacetylamidophosphate (L–=Cl3CC(O)NP(O)(OCH3)2) has been obtained. Based on IR data, the bidentate coordination mode of the carbacylamidophosphate ligand is suggested. The centrosymmetric binuclear complex [Cr2(L)4(μ2–OCH3)2] has molecular structure according to X-ray analysis. The phosphoramidic ligands are coordinated in a bidentate manner via oxygen atoms of phosphoryl and carbonyl groups, and the coordination polyhedra represent the cis-isomer. The coordination environment of the central ion possesses a distorted octahedral geometry with c.n.=6.
